Understanding Your Tire Pressure
Monitoring System (TPMS)
The Tire Pressure Monitoring System measures pressure in
your four road tires and sends the tire pressure readings to your
vehicle. The Low Tire warning light will turn ON if the tire
pressure is below the minimum pressure. Once the light is illu-
minated, one or more of your tires is under-inflated and needs
to be inflated to the manufacturer’s recommended tire pres-
sure. Even if the light turns ON and a short time later turns
OFF, your tire pressure still needs to be checked.
